Royals Charities Kids Holiday Party set for Tuesday

Club Also Supports Johnson County Christmas Bureau, Cops and Kids Events this Holiday Season

KANSAS CITY, MO (December 2, 2013) - The Kansas City Royals and Royals Charities will be involved in a number of holiday activities this week, beginning with the Royals Charities Kids Holiday Party set for Tuesday, December 3 at Kauffman Stadium.
 
ROYALS CHARITIES KIDS HOLIDAY PARTY - Tuesday, December 3
During the fifth annual party, which is scheduled for 4-6 p.m. in the Kia Diamond Club, Royals Charities will host children from four area organizations - Della Lamb, El Centro, Inc., Niles Home and Operation Breakthrough. These children will participate in holiday-themed activities such as decorating cookies and making ornaments. In addition, each child will receive a gift from Santa Claus and Sluggerrr Claus purchased by Royals associates and leave with a stocking full of goodies. The gift may be the only present that they receive this holiday season.

The holiday party is a private event for the select children from the four charitable organizations. Media members wishing to cover the event should enter Kauffman Stadium at Home Plate Gate C.
 
JOHNSON COUNTY CHRISTMAS BUREAU HOLIDAY SHOP - Friday, December 6
Sluggerrr will join Royals associates in distributing food, winter clothing and holiday gifts beginning at 2 p.m. at the Johnson County Christmas Bureau Holiday Shop, located at the former Marshalls store in the northeast corner of the Great Mall of the Great Plains (20090 West 151st Street in Olathe, Kan.).

The Johnson County Christmas Bureau is a volunteer, non-profit organization and United Way agency created in 1960 that provides necessary assistance to low-income families of Johnson County, Kansas. Qualified low-income families and individuals are scheduled by appointment and assisted by a volunteer during one of the nine days of the Holiday Shop to select groceries, toys, gifts, personal care items and clothing for their families. The Holiday Shop was established in 1977.

More than 3,400 families and 640 nursing home residents were served by the Holiday Shop in 2012.

COPS AND KIDS - Saturday, December 14
In addition, the Royals will once again support the Topeka (Kan.) Police Department's Cops and Kids event on Saturday, December 14. Police officers will be paired with children from Big Brothers Big Sisters of Topeka to help them with their holiday shopping beginning at 8:30 a.m. at the WalMart located at 1501 SW Wanamaker Road in Topeka. Sluggerrr will make a special appearance to visit the children at the store from 8:30-9:30 a.m. The cops will then assist members of TARC in their shopping efforts beginning at 11 a.m. at the WalMart located at 2600 NW Rochester Road in Topeka.
